Making the Most of Your Design Asset
To leverage the Round Frame. Rope Decorative Border. Jut effectively, a thoughtful approach is key. Here’s some practical guidance for integrating it into your work.
Evaluate Project Fit: First, consider if the asset's personality aligns with your project's goals. It’s an excellent fit for themes of nature, tradition, comfort, and craftsmanship. For ultra-modern, minimalist, or high-tech brands, it might feel out of place unless used ironically or in a very stylized way. The context of your overall brand identity is crucial.
Test Font Pairings Thoughtfully: If you're placing text inside the frame, the choice of typeface is critical. The rustic texture of the rope pairs beautifully with certain font categories. A clean, sturdy sans serif font can create a pleasing modern contrast. A classic serif font can enhance the traditional feel. A genuine handwritten font or script font can amplify the artisanal vibe, but be sure it remains legible at small sizes. Avoid overly ornate or technical fonts that might clash with the organic rope texture.
Consider the Format and Color: The asset is provided in EPS, JPG, SVG, and transparent PNG formats. The transparent PNG is your go-to for layering in design software like Canva, Photoshop, or Illustrator. The SVG format is excellent for scaling without loss of quality, perfect for large print projects. While the description specifies a white background for the JPG, the other formats likely allow you to change the fill color of the circle's interior, offering more creative flexibility.
Ensure Readability and Hierarchy: When using the frame, remember it's a strong visual element. If you place text inside, ensure there is sufficient contrast and padding. The rope border, while decorative, shouldn't overwhelm the core message. Use it to create a focal point, but balance it with simpler surrounding elements in your overall layout to maintain a clear visual hierarchy.
Review Commercial Licensing: This is a non-negotiable step for any professional project. Before using the Round Frame in a client logo, a product for sale, or mass-produced marketing materials, you must verify the licensing terms. Most premium font and asset marketplaces offer clear commercial licenses, but always read the specifics. Understanding whether the license covers digital use, physical products, and the number of end projects is essential for professional and legal compliance.
